面向智慧教室的嵌入式控制系統(tǒng)設(shè)計(jì)與實(shí)現(xiàn)
本文關(guān)鍵詞:面向智慧教室的嵌入式控制系統(tǒng)設(shè)計(jì)與實(shí)現(xiàn)
更多相關(guān)文章: 嵌入式控制 遠(yuǎn)程遙控 智慧教室 跨平臺(tái)開(kāi)發(fā)
【摘要】:隨著物聯(lián)網(wǎng)技術(shù)的發(fā)展,智慧城市、智慧交通、智慧醫(yī)療和智慧教室等都成為了互聯(lián)網(wǎng)時(shí)代的重要研究?jī)?nèi)容。以實(shí)現(xiàn)智慧教室環(huán)境的智能感知、遠(yuǎn)程操控以及多網(wǎng)融合等功能的智慧教室控制系統(tǒng)也成為了目前研究的熱點(diǎn)。以往的控制系統(tǒng)主要有PC、單片機(jī)和嵌入式系統(tǒng)三種實(shí)現(xiàn)方式,三者各有優(yōu)缺點(diǎn)。PC機(jī)功能強(qiáng)大,卻有功耗大、成本高和實(shí)用性差等缺點(diǎn);單片機(jī)體現(xiàn)其控制的專業(yè)性,價(jià)格便宜,但往往無(wú)法滿足更多的應(yīng)用需求;嵌入式系統(tǒng)價(jià)格相對(duì)便宜,可以根據(jù)需要對(duì)軟硬件進(jìn)行裁剪,其專業(yè)性也很強(qiáng),但出于復(fù)雜性和成本考慮,不可能給每個(gè)控制設(shè)備都搭建嵌入式系統(tǒng)。若采用三者中任何單一技術(shù)實(shí)現(xiàn)控制系統(tǒng),往往都無(wú)法滿足實(shí)際項(xiàng)目的需求。因此,論文以嵌入式技術(shù)為核心,實(shí)現(xiàn)了有線網(wǎng)絡(luò)、WiFi無(wú)線網(wǎng)絡(luò)和ZigBee網(wǎng)絡(luò)的多網(wǎng)融合,開(kāi)發(fā)了PC和Android平臺(tái)的控制終端,并利用ZigBee單片機(jī)搭載傳感器或其他硬件設(shè)備,設(shè)計(jì)并實(shí)現(xiàn)了智慧教室的控制系統(tǒng)。論文主要工作:(1)智慧教室嵌入式控制系統(tǒng)設(shè)計(jì)。從對(duì)智慧控制系統(tǒng)的需求分析開(kāi)始,展開(kāi)對(duì)控制系統(tǒng)的體系結(jié)構(gòu)以及功能的分析,并設(shè)計(jì)控制系統(tǒng)的通信功能以及通信的控制命令協(xié)議。(2)智慧教室嵌入式系統(tǒng)開(kāi)發(fā)。搭建嵌入式系統(tǒng)開(kāi)發(fā)環(huán)境,設(shè)計(jì)并實(shí)現(xiàn)智慧教室控制系統(tǒng)的客戶端、服務(wù)器以及ZigBee無(wú)線操控程序。(3)智慧教室嵌入式控制系統(tǒng)的測(cè)試與分析。對(duì)整個(gè)系統(tǒng)進(jìn)行測(cè)試,采用串口工具、網(wǎng)絡(luò)命令測(cè)試軟件以及不同平臺(tái)的客戶端軟件完成對(duì)系統(tǒng)功能的測(cè)試。最后將系統(tǒng)發(fā)布,并提出系統(tǒng)軟件升級(jí)的方案。與同類研究相比,本文的特色之處在于:根據(jù)智慧教室控制系統(tǒng)需求定制嵌入式Linux系統(tǒng),實(shí)現(xiàn)教室環(huán)境的智能感知、遠(yuǎn)程操控及多網(wǎng)融合功能。制定與ZigBee協(xié)調(diào)器通信的控制命令通訊協(xié)議,與簡(jiǎn)單的命令碼不同,該協(xié)議帶有校驗(yàn)功能,更加符合實(shí)際項(xiàng)目開(kāi)發(fā)的需要。采用C/S軟件開(kāi)發(fā)架構(gòu),跨平臺(tái)的Qt作為主要的編程工具,開(kāi)發(fā)Windows、Linux和Android不同平臺(tái)運(yùn)行的控制終端程序。提出采用U盤(pán)更新智慧教室控制系統(tǒng)軟件的方案。
【關(guān)鍵詞】:嵌入式控制 遠(yuǎn)程遙控 智慧教室 跨平臺(tái)開(kāi)發(fā)
【學(xué)位授予單位】:華中師范大學(xué)
【學(xué)位級(jí)別】:碩士
【學(xué)位授予年份】:2016
【分類號(hào)】:TP273;G434
【目錄】:
- 摘要5-6
- Abstract6-11
- 1 緒論11-16
- 1.1 研究背景和意義11-12
- 1.2 國(guó)內(nèi)外研究現(xiàn)狀12-13
- 1.3 研究?jī)?nèi)容和思路13-14
- 1.3.1 研究?jī)?nèi)容13-14
- 1.3.2 研究思路14
- 1.4 論文組織結(jié)構(gòu)14-16
- 2 智慧教室相關(guān)理論及技術(shù)基礎(chǔ)16-27
- 2.1 “智慧教室”界定16
- 2.2 物聯(lián)網(wǎng)相關(guān)技術(shù)16-22
- 2.2.1 嵌入式系統(tǒng)16-17
- 2.2.2 Qt技術(shù)17-18
- 2.2.3 網(wǎng)絡(luò)通信技術(shù)18-19
- 2.2.4 串口通信技術(shù)19-20
- 2.2.5 ZigBee技術(shù)20-22
- 2.3 智慧教室控制系統(tǒng)硬件簡(jiǎn)介22-26
- 2.3.1 網(wǎng)關(guān)開(kāi)發(fā)板22-24
- 2.3.2 ZigBee開(kāi)發(fā)板24
- 2.3.3 外設(shè)硬件24-26
- 2.4 本章小結(jié)26-27
- 3 智慧教室嵌入式控制系統(tǒng)設(shè)計(jì)27-36
- 3.1 智慧教室控制系統(tǒng)需求分析27-28
- 3.1.1 控制系統(tǒng)概述27
- 3.1.2 外部接口需求27
- 3.1.3 功能需求27-28
- 3.2 智慧教室控制系統(tǒng)結(jié)構(gòu)分析28-29
- 3.3 智慧教室控制系統(tǒng)功能分析29
- 3.4 控制系統(tǒng)通信功能設(shè)計(jì)29-31
- 3.4.1 系統(tǒng)通信模型29-30
- 3.4.2 系統(tǒng)通信時(shí)序30-31
- 3.5 控制命令協(xié)議設(shè)計(jì)31-35
- 3.5.1 功能碼設(shè)計(jì)31-32
- 3.5.2 控制命令報(bào)文格式32-33
- 3.5.3 控制命令實(shí)例33-35
- 3.6 本章小結(jié)35-36
- 4 智慧教室嵌入式控制系統(tǒng)開(kāi)發(fā)36-55
- 4.1 構(gòu)建嵌入式Linux開(kāi)發(fā)環(huán)境36-39
- 4.1.1 嵌入式Linux系統(tǒng)搭建36-38
- 4.1.2 軟件移植與環(huán)境配置38-39
- 4.2 網(wǎng)關(guān)服務(wù)器端程序設(shè)計(jì)與實(shí)現(xiàn)39-46
- 4.2.1 功能分析39
- 4.2.2 程序流程設(shè)計(jì)39-41
- 4.2.3 網(wǎng)關(guān)控制功能模塊設(shè)計(jì)與實(shí)現(xiàn)41-46
- 4.3 嵌入式控制系統(tǒng)的客戶端設(shè)計(jì)與實(shí)現(xiàn)46-48
- 4.3.1 功能分析46
- 4.3.2 程序流程設(shè)計(jì)46-47
- 4.3.3 客戶端功能模塊設(shè)計(jì)與實(shí)現(xiàn)47-48
- 4.4 ZigBee程序設(shè)計(jì)與實(shí)現(xiàn)48-54
- 4.4.1 功能分析48
- 4.4.2 程序流程設(shè)計(jì)48-49
- 4.4.3 ZigBee程序功能模塊設(shè)計(jì)與實(shí)現(xiàn)49-54
- 4.5 本章小結(jié)54-55
- 5 智慧教室嵌入式控制系統(tǒng)的測(cè)試與分析55-63
- 5.1 軟件的編譯55-56
- 5.1.1 Qt程序的編譯55
- 5.1.2 ZigBee程序的編譯55-56
- 5.2 系統(tǒng)功能測(cè)試56-59
- 5.2.1 串口命令測(cè)試56
- 5.2.2 網(wǎng)絡(luò)命令調(diào)試工具測(cè)試56-57
- 5.2.3 智慧教室控制系統(tǒng)的應(yīng)用實(shí)例57-59
- 5.3 系統(tǒng)的發(fā)布59-61
- 5.4 系統(tǒng)軟件升級(jí)61-62
- 5.4.1 U盤(pán)掛載61-62
- 5.4.2 軟件升級(jí)62
- 5.5 本章小結(jié)62-63
- 6 總結(jié)與展望63-65
- 6.1 工作總結(jié)63
- 6.2 工作展望63-65
- 參考文獻(xiàn)65-68
- 攻讀碩士學(xué)位期間發(fā)表的學(xué)術(shù)論文及參與的項(xiàng)目68-69
- 致謝69
【參考文獻(xiàn)】
中國(guó)期刊全文數(shù)據(jù)庫(kù) 前10條
1 段素平;;基于ZigBee技術(shù)的數(shù)據(jù)采集自組網(wǎng)系統(tǒng)設(shè)計(jì)[J];電子世界;2015年18期
2 陳侃松;邵沖;張丹;張滿意;何林桂;;基于S3C2440平臺(tái)的USB_WiFi驅(qū)動(dòng)移植[J];物聯(lián)網(wǎng)技術(shù);2015年05期
3 黃翩;張瓊;祝婷;;基于Qt的一個(gè)服務(wù)器多個(gè)客戶端的TCP通信[J];電子科技;2015年03期
4 熊星星;何月順;;基于S5PV210的U-boot分析與移植[J];計(jì)算機(jī)系統(tǒng)應(yīng)用;2015年01期
5 陳磊;徐佳麗;;基于物聯(lián)網(wǎng)的高職智慧教室建設(shè)研究[J];職教論壇;2014年35期
6 劉艷鳳;;基于Zigbee網(wǎng)絡(luò)的分層網(wǎng)絡(luò)框架體系分析[J];信息與電腦(理論版);2014年10期
7 王玉龍;蔣家傅;;以需求為導(dǎo)向的智慧教室系統(tǒng)構(gòu)建[J];現(xiàn)代教育技術(shù);2014年06期
8 劉潔;黃鑫;;基因擴(kuò)增儀與PC機(jī)串口通信的設(shè)計(jì)與實(shí)現(xiàn)[J];電腦知識(shí)與技術(shù);2014年04期
9 張亞珍;張寶輝;韓云霞;;國(guó)內(nèi)外智慧教室研究評(píng)論及展望[J];開(kāi)放教育研究;2014年01期
10 張劍英;李宗為;張祥忠;李金;;一種基于ARM11的無(wú)線AP進(jìn)程移植方法[J];電視技術(shù);2013年15期
,本文編號(hào):624079
本文鏈接:http://sikaile.net/jiaoyulunwen/jiaoyutizhilunwen/624079.html